Peter's Story

Peter is just over a year old (born in 2025), fully neutered, ridiculously handsome, and somehow knows it. We believe Peter is some sort of Dwarf mix, He’s the king of binkies, a professional snack enthusiast, and firmly believes every human activity should include him in some way.<br/><br/>Peter would thrive in a home where he can enjoy lots of free roam time, because being stuck in an x-pen is simply not part of his personal brand. Peter is a man about town, so he doesn't have much time for pets. However, he absolutely loves being around his humans. He’ll happily flop beside you, crawl into your lap when you least expect it, and supervise your daily routine like a tiny furry manager.<br/><br/>If you’re looking for a bunny with personality, charm, and just the right amount of sass, Peter is your guy. He is used to gentle children who respect rabbits. <br/><br/>Peter's adoption fee is $100. Adopters must be at least 18 years old.

West Michigan Critter Haven's Adoption Policy
How To Adopt a Pet from West Michigan Critter Haven 1. Apply to adopt via our online application at https://wmicritterhaven.org/adoption-application/. 2. When your application is received an adoption counselor will contact you to set up an adoption interview. 3. Upon approval from the Board of Directors and verification of references, approved adopters can then meet animals in their foster homes for adoption. As a note, the adoption process can take anywhere from two days to a week depending on schedules. West Michigan Critter Haven is made up of a group of volunteers who also have full-time jobs. We appreciate your patience in scheduling interviews and meet-and-greets!
